Who are we and what do we do?

We are seeking a Analog Design Manager for our development team, which is part of the Low Power Audio (LPA) product line, which is part of Audio BU. This role provides a unique opportunity to be part of a world-class team that develops best-in-class audio amplifiers which cater to a wide array of market segments and end-applications including cellphones, tablets, IoT devices, smart speakers etc. TI being a market leader in this technology domain, this role provides the challenge to drive continuous innovation while executing to the demands of the market. These products contain multiple sub-systems, which include high performance higher-order Class-D stages, high accuracy sense circuitry for speaker protection and corrections, data converters (sigma delta ADCs, DACs, SAR ADCs), power systems(boost converters, charge pumps, LDOs) etc. which are built as part of a complex audio SoC which provides all the smarts of a SmartAmp device.
